Python自动化工具:一键更新生产订单周报图表

需积分: 5 0 下载量 36 浏览量 更新于2024-12-07 收藏 442KB ZIP 举报
资源摘要信息:"Python一键更新Excel档“生产订单周报”的图表.zip是一个自动化办公工具,通过Python编程实现对Excel文件中的生产订单周报图表进行快速更新。工具的核心价值在于简化和加速数据处理与可视化过程,通过以下几个主要步骤实现其功能: 1. 读取Excel文件:Python的一系列内置库,尤其是pandas和openpyxl,提供了强大的数据读取能力。pandas库以其强大的DataFrame对象为数据提供了高效的数据结构,能够处理和操作大量的表格数据。openpyxl则是一个专门处理Excel文件的库,它可以读写Excel 2010 xlsx/xlsm/xltx/xltm文件。这两个库的结合使用可以实现对Excel文件的高效读取,并将数据存储在内存中进行下一步处理。 2. 数据筛选与处理:Python通过其简洁的语法和强大的数据处理能力,使得对数据的筛选、排序和计算变得非常便捷。用户可以根据实际需求进行复杂的数据操作,以获取生产订单周报所需的具体数据。 3. 图表生成:Python在数据可视化方面同样表现出色,提供了matplotlib、seaborn等高质量的图表库。matplotlib是一个绘图库,提供了丰富的API来绘制各种静态、动态、交互式的图表。而seaborn则在matplotlib的基础上进一步简化了绘图过程,提供了更为美观的默认主题和色彩配置。这些库能够帮助用户根据处理后的数据生成折线图、柱状图、饼图等各类图表,从而清晰展示生产订单的变化趋势和分布情况。 4. 图表更新:该工具设计为自动化运行,用户在需要更新图表时,只需运行工具即可,无需手动操作。工具会自动执行数据的读取、处理和图表生成等一系列流程,大大节省了用户在数据处理和图表更新上的时间和精力。 5. 结果输出:生成的图表既可以保存为图片文件,也可以直接插入到原始Excel文件中。这样的输出方式让用户能够方便地查看和分享图表,满足了不同用户的需求。 对于那些需要频繁处理大量数据的办公人员,或是希望提升自己数据处理和自动化能力的Python爱好者来说,这个工具无疑是一个非常好的辅助,能够显著提高工作效率并减少错误。 在标签方面,该工具与"python"、"python自动化"、"python源码"、"python办公"以及"办公自动化"这些关键词紧密相关。这反映了工具的开发语言、主要功能以及应用场景。 从文件名称列表可以看出,该工具的具体文件名称就是"Python一键更新Excel档“生产订单周报”的图表",这直接点明了工具的功能和目的,让潜在用户能够快速理解其提供的服务。 综上所述,Python一键更新Excel档“生产订单周报”的图表.zip是一个高效、实用的自动化办公解决方案,通过Python强大的功能和灵活性,为用户提供了简单、快速的数据处理和可视化更新途径。"